"textContent": "An autonomous lawn mower comprises an outer housing, a prime mover within the output housing configured to move the autonomous lawn mower, a battery within the output housing configured to supply power to the prime mover, a docking socket formed in the outer housing to receive a corresponding plug element of a charging dock, the docking socket including first and second docking sensors at first and second sensing positions along an internal length of the docking socket, and a charging controller to switch the battery to a charging mode in response to the first docking sensor sensing the plug element at the first sensing position, and send a stopping signal to the prime mover to stop the autonomous lawn mower moving forward in response to the second magnetic sensor sensing the plug element at the second sensing position.",
"title": "AUTONOMOUS LAWN MOWER, CHARGING METHOD AND CHARGING DOCK"
